Найти в Дзене
Уроки Linux

📡 Как быстро настроить репликацию баз данных на Linux

📡 Как быстро настроить репликацию баз данных на Linux

Вы когда-нибудь мечтали о бесперебойной работе и синхронизации данных между серверами? Погрузимся в практический пример — настройку репликации базы данных, чтобы данные были всегда под рукой и безопасны!

Это проще, чем кажется. В этом посте я расскажу, как сделать репликацию на примере MySQL, чтобы вы легко воссоздали эту систему у себя.

- Преимущества:

- Высокая доступность данных

- Балансировка нагрузки

- Безопасная автоматическая синхронизация

- Первое, что нужно — убедиться, что у обоих серверов установлен MySQL и настроен для удаленного соединения.

- На основном сервере активируем режим репликации, добавляя в конфиг my.cnf строки:

server-id=1

log_bin=mysql-bin

binlog_do_db=ваша_база

- На вторичном — присваиваем другой server-id и указываем хоста мастера:

server-id=2

relay_log=relay-log

master-host=IP_мастера

master-user=replica

master-password=ваш_пароль

- После этого — запускаем команды на клонирование базы и начинаем репликацию.

Это — краеугольный камень для понимания, как автоматизировать миграцию данных и обеспечить отказоустойчивость системы.

Всегда ли репликация кажется сложной? А ведь всё — всего лишь правильные настройки и немного команд!

А ты уже использовал репликацию в своих проектах или только мечтаешь о ней?

🚀 Прокачай свои скилы в телеграм канале https://t.me/LinuxSkill а пройти тесты на знание linux в боте https://t.me/gradeliftbot

📩 Завтра: Как настроить Fail2Ban за 5 минут! Включи 🔔 чтобы не пропустить!